Just be careful guys. We got gipped when we went. Not only did they not go all the way to 6000, but got the wrong gear. From what Howie says our 1.00 ratio is in our fourth Gear, yet they did it in 5th and 6th gear. With the add ons on the car they said we had less horsepower than a stock LT1. Yeah they said we had about 295 at the rear, and the stock car had 318 at the rear. hmmmm something isn't right with this picture..

Kewl, a 6th gear dyno pull. Now, why didnt I think of that???!!! I would think that a 320 +/- is about right for a LT1 with cam and bolt-ons ie header/CAI.... Bone stock a M6 LT1 should dyno 250-260, a A4 in the 230-240 range, that is if everyone isnt lieing about the results.

It would be nice to have accurate numbers, so the bench racing would be more legit, but I would go for consistency.
One of the car TV shows did a N20 install on a DRM LS1, and the baseline pull(s) w/exhaust and lid was a whopping 270-280, so maybe they did a 6th gear pull also!
